When it comes to choosing your wall decor by color, I don't generally like using bright, bold monochrome abstracts. I know some people like to use them because they want a patch of a certain color on their wall. My thought is that a throw pillow can add plain color, or a table cloth, but a photo can be much more interesting than that.
Most of the photos I like in these color categories will feature a certain prominent color, but not be overwhelmed by it, and usually not be monochrome. There are exceptions, such as "Chinese Fisherman on Rafts" in the blue section, which I find extremely calming.
I also do not include close-up flower photos. There are many of those to choose from, in any flower color you need. But very few stand out from the crowd.
